Details of IFSC Code for Bank Of Maharashtra, Borivli East, Mumbai, Mumbai Suburban
Here are the main details that are associated with the IFSC Code MAHB0000306 of Bank Of Maharashtra for its branch located in Mumbai Suburban, within the district of Mumbai in the state of Maharashtra.
| Particulars | Details |
|---|---|
| Bank | Bank Of Maharashtra |
| IFSC Code | MAHB0000306 |
| Branch | Borivli East, Mumbai |
| City | Mumbai Suburban |
| District | Mumbai |
| State | Maharashtra |
| Address | Lav-Kush Shoppg.Centre, Dattapada Rd, Borivali E , Mumbai |

What Is IFSC Code and Why Is It Important?
IFSC stands for Indian Financial System Code, an 11-character alphanumeric code provided by the Reserve Bank of India. Every bank branch, including Bank Of Maharashtra located in Borivli East, Mumbai, Mumbai Suburban, Maharashtra, is provided with a unique IFSC like MAHB0000306 to ensure that online payments reach the right destination.
The IFSC Code is important because:
- It uniquely identifies the Bank Of Maharashtra branch in Mumbai Suburban.
- It helps NEFT, RTGS, and IMPS systems route the transfer securely.
- It avoids any errors or confusions between multiple branches of the same bank across different places like Mumbai Suburban and Mumbai.
- It reduces errors in fund transfers and improves accuracy.
- It allows sender banks to validate and confirm branch details before processing payments.
There are thousands of branches across Maharashtra and the rest of India and the IFSC Code ensures that transactions meant for Bank Of Maharashtra in Borivli East, Mumbai do not get mixed with another location.
Format of the IFSC Code MAHB0000306
This is the format of the IFSC Code for banks, including Bank Of Maharashtra, follows an 11-character structure:
AAAA0CCCCCC
Here's the explanation:
- First 4 characters (AAAA): This is the bank code. For Bank Of Maharashtra, these characters are the bank's short identifier.
- 5th character (0): This stays zero till there is any future use.
- Last 6 characters (CCCCCC): These are specific branch code assigned to branches such as Borivli East, Mumbai in Mumbai Suburban.
For example, the IFSC Code MAHB0000306 of Bank Of Maharashtra for the Borivli East, Mumbai branch includes these elements, identifying the bank and the branch location in Mumbai Suburban and Maharashtra accurately.

How to Use IFSC Code MAHB0000306 for Online Transfers?
Once you have the IFSC Code MAHB0000306 for the Borivli East, Mumbai branch of Bank Of Maharashtra in Mumbai Suburban, you can initiate your fund transfers using any digital method:
NEFT
Add the beneficiary's name, account number, and IFSC Code MAHB0000306. The transfer is completed in batches. It is useful for both personal and business payments.
RTGS
Used for payments over ₹2 lakh. Real-time settlement using the IFSC Code of the recipient branch.
IMPS
Instant 24×7 transfers. Requires the recipient's account details and Bank Of Maharashtra IFSC Code MAHB0000306.
No matter which payment method you use, the IFSC Code must be correct. If you enter the wrong IFSC Code for the Bank Of Maharashtra Borivli East, Mumbai in Mumbai Suburban, your payment can get delayed or might not go through at all.
